Key Responsibilities:
Test Planning & Execution: Design, document, and execute detailed manual test cases based on functional specifications and user requirements for banking applications (internet banking, payments, loans, mobile apps).
Collaborate: Work closely with developers, business analysts, and stakeholders to understand requirements, review test cases, and ensure proper test coverage.
Defect Management:
Log, track, and manage software defects using test management tools like JIRA or HP ALM, and collaborate with the development team to ensure resolution.User-Centric Testing:
Verify UI/UX consistency, validate transaction flows, and ensure security compliance and localization accuracy from the end-user’s perspective.Regression & UAT Support:
Conduct regression testing for new releases and production fixes. Support User Acceptance Testing (UAT) with test planning, execution, and documentation.Reviews & Walkthroughs:
Participate in test walkthroughs, sign-offs, and reviews to ensure alignment between business goals and QA activities.
